Influence over decision makers

We help people who feel powerless to share their stories, build communities and convince politicians and big corporations to listen. Connecting petition starters with people in power helps create meaningful changes in policies, laws and business practices.

Nurses Theresa Brown and Dr. Daihnia Dunkley successfully petitioned President Joe Biden to appoint a nurse to his Covid-19 task force. This team developed important action plans that influenced millions of lives across the United States, and thanks to their respective petitions, there was a critical voice in the room from the frontlines of the pandemic.

Expert campaign advice

Most people who start petitions are new to the world of advocacy and activism. Our staff provide advice for mobilizing support, generating media interest and lobbying elected officials.

Belinda Bradley struggled to find the best route for a trip with her mom in a wheelchair. By launching her petition and mobilizing support from 300,000 people, she convinced the world’s biggest tech company, Google, to help disabled people all over the world.
